Hi, I'm posting from Australia, so I don't have the luxury of sticking my head under a vehicle or slipping down to the local wrecker to check things out....so I am hoping you guys can help me out on this one.


I am seeking a High Pinion IFS/SLA Dana 35 front axle for a hybrid project of mine. I understand that the Dana 35TTB front is high pinion , but I am really seeking an SLA IFS housing, such as in the Explorers after 95, but I need it to be a high pinion version.

Was there ever such an animal created?

If there are any 35 axle gurus out there ...I'd like to hear from you.

Hi there. The SLA IFS D35 is a low pinion type. As you stated, the D35 TTB is Hi Pinion style. As I type, I cannot recall any SLA IFS front diff that is a hi pinion in any vehicle line ( chev, ford, dodge) Maybe imports??
